Following China’s recent show of support, Turkiye has also voiced solidarity with Pakistan amid rising tensions with India, highlighting the long-standing and close ties between Ankara and Islamabad.

During a meeting in Islamabad with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if, the Turkish ambassador emphasized the need for calm and stability in South Asia. He urged all involved nations to act with restraint, especially in light of India’s recent provocative statements.

Prime Minister Sharif appreciated Turkiye’s backing, calling it a testament to the deep-rooted friendship between both countries. He stated that Pakistan remains committed to economic progress and counter-terrorism, and sees India’s aggressive posture as an attempt to distract from Pakistan’s positive efforts.

Sharif reiterated Pakistan’s offer for a transparent international investigation into the Pahalgam attack and welcomed the idea of Turkiye’s participation. The Turkish envoy reaffirmed support for Pakistan’s stance, calling for a diplomatic and peaceful resolution to prevent further escalation in the region. China had earlier expressed similar support, increasing India’s diplomatic isolation.
